President Donald Trump visits North Dakota on Wednesday, July 1, for the dedication ceremony of the Theodore Roosevelt Presidential Library. Located in Medora, the massive facility explores the 26th president's life and the conservation values he developed while ranching and hunting in the 1880s. This visit precedes the official grand opening scheduled for July 4, with the President attending as one of several distinguished guests at the rugged site in the North Dakota landscape.
